  • Beinn Iutharn Mhor is a 1,045m Munro mountain in the Scottish Highlands. It can either be climbed from Inverey in the north (together with Carn Bhac) or from the Spittal of Glenshee in the south (together with Glas Tulaichean and Carn an Righ). I chose the latter. There's a real feeling of visiting a remote wildnerness in this area. You're miles from a road and over 1,000m above sea level.
